Understanding APY: The Basics

Before diving into the hunt for safe APY opportunities, it’s crucial to grasp what APY truly represents. Unlike simple interest rates, APY accounts for the effects of compounding interest. This means that the interest you earn is added back to your account, and future interest is calculated on the increased balance. The formula to calculate APY is:

[ \text{APY} = \left(1 + \frac{r}{n}\right)^n - 1 ]

where ( r ) is the annual interest rate and ( n ) is the number of compounding periods per year.

For example, if you have an investment with an annual interest rate of 5% compounded monthly, your APY would be calculated as:

[ \text{APY} = \left(1 + \frac{0.05}{12}\right)^{12} - 1 \approx 0.05126 \text{ or } 5.13\% ]

Understanding this formula helps you compare different investment opportunities and choose the ones that truly maximize your returns.

Factors to Consider in Safe APY Opportunities

When looking for safe APY opportunities, several factors come into play to ensure not just high returns, but also the security of your investment. Here are some key elements to consider:

Liquidity: Ensure that the investment you’re considering allows for easy access to your funds. Liquid investments are safer because you can withdraw your money without significant penalties or delays.

Reputation of the Institution: Research the financial institution offering the APY. Established banks, credit unions, and reputable fintech platforms typically offer more secure opportunities. Look for institutions with strong financial health ratings and positive customer reviews.

Minimum Investment Requirements: Some high-yield APY opportunities might require substantial initial investments. Make sure the minimum investment aligns with your financial capacity and goals.

Fees and Charges: Be wary of hidden fees that can erode your returns. Compare the APY with the total cost of any associated fees to determine the real return on your investment.

Inflation Rate: Consider the inflation rate when evaluating APY opportunities. APY should ideally be higher than the current inflation rate to ensure that your purchasing power isn't eroded over time.

Platforms to Uncover Safe APY Opportunities

Savings and Money Market Accounts: Major banks and credit unions often offer high-yield savings accounts and money market accounts with competitive APYs. Websites like Bankrate and NerdWallet regularly update their lists of top-performing accounts.

Certificates of Deposit (CDs): CDs offer fixed interest rates over a specified term, often providing higher APYs than standard savings accounts. Laddering CDs with different maturity dates can maximize returns while maintaining liquidity.

High-Yield Online Banks: Online banks like Ally, Discover, and Marcus offer competitive APYs without the need for large minimum balances. These platforms often provide more flexible access to your funds compared to traditional banks.

Robo-Advisors: Robo-advisors like Betterment and Wealthfront use algorithms to manage your portfolio based on your financial goals and risk tolerance. They often provide diversified investment options with competitive APYs.

Navigating Regulatory and Security Aspects

Insurance Protection: Ensure that your investments are insured by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C) or National Credit Union Administration (NCUA) to protect against bank failures. FDIC insurance covers deposits up to $250,000 per depositor, per institution.

Background Checks on Platforms: Always conduct thorough background checks on any investment platform. Look for reviews, ratings, and any regulatory actions that might indicate potential risks.

Data Security Measures: Financial platforms should have robust data security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Look for platforms that use encryption and other advanced security technologies.
